Merge tag 'efi-2025-01-rc1' of https://source.denx.de/u-boot/custodians/u-boot-efi
Pull request efi-2025-01-rc1
Documentation:
* Move the generic memory-documentation to doc/
* Fix typo boormethod
UEFI:
* Delete rng-seed if having EFI RNG protocol
* Don't call restart_uboot in EFI watchdog test
* Simplify building EFI binaries in Makefile
* Show FirmwareVendor and FirmwareRevision in helloworld
* Add debug output for efi bootmeth
Other:
* CONFIG_CMD_CLK should depend on CONFIG_CLK
* simplify clk command
* enable clk command on the sandbox
